The Health Ministry’s Permanent Secretary Dr James Fong says they are reviewing their restrictions in the West and North and will be making more definitive announcements in the next few days.

Dr. Fong says they have received more detailed data regarding the effectiveness of the containment measures in the Northern and Western Divisions.

He says the Lautoka Hospital has ended their 21-day isolation with almost all patients discharged yesterday.

He confirms the hospital has also discharged its last 2 COVID-19 patients as they have recovered.

Dr Fong says with the recovery of these 2 patients there will be 0 active cases in the West, and it has also been 15 days since the last case was reported from that division.
